Malicious code in extfetchedwand1778555624 (RubyGems)
The RubyGems package extfetchedwand1778555624 version 0.0.1 is identified as containing malicious code. This package is flagged in the OpenSSF malicious packages database and is recognized as a security threat due to its malicious nature. No specific technical details about the malicious behavior or exploitation methods are provided. There is no indication of known exploits in the wild. No patch or remediation is currently available for this package version.
